Output e641676928ea7c8ae9915bfed2962aa4f8e11049ce942468ed9e50c7b9758941:19

value
1026065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cc4add79f15ca5258e503ebc0dfa413c9a09076 OP_EQUAL
address
3Ju8a7J259g6Mnijm3D4S1V52BEDs17ZBn
transaction
e641676928ea7c8ae9915bfed2962aa4f8e11049ce942468ed9e50c7b9758941
spent
true